‘Free Palestine’ Vandals Indicted After Yearlong Campaign Against Jewish, University Targets

Jun 10, 2026·2 min read

FBI Director Kash Patel announced the early morning arrests of seven people Wednesday on a 10-count indictment for attacks on and harassment of leaders at the University of Michigan and businesses in the eastern district of Michigan.

Patel wrote that according to the indictment, “a group of college-aged adults engaged in a coordinated campaign of violent, criminal acts seeking to pressure University of Michigan leaders and other businesses in the Eastern District of Michigan to cut off all ties with Israel.”

Some of the acts that were committed included breaking windows by throwing jars of chemicals through the windows of homes in which children were sleeping, leaving threatening notes, spray-painting “Free Palestine” and “Intifada” on houses and other acts of vandalism.

Patel alleged in his statement that the perpetrators deliberately chose the one-year anniversary of the Oct. 7 Hamas attack on Israel to commit their most visible crimes, targeting on Oct. 7, 2024, the Bloomfield Township Jewish Federation and vandalizing the home of the president of the University of Michigan, with the latter act committed by an employee of the university.

The criminal acts took place for about a year, from March 2024 to April 2025, according to the statement.

Patel praised the Detroit FBI and its partners for conducting “a thorough, detailed investigation of this case” and charging those involved “for their alleged role in conspiracies to transmit threats in interstate and foreign commerce.”

The Department of Justice stated that eight conspirators had been indicted.

“In America, we rule by law, not by fear,” said Jerome F. Gorgon Jr., U.S. attorney for the eastern district of Michigan. “These alleged threats and attempts to terrorize government officials, businesses and the Jewish Federation are anti-American. We will counter intimidation with justice.”
